Tasting Notes
Colour
Deep amber-gold with coppery undertones and mahogany edges, a warm, glossy hue that gleams with age.
Nose
Opulent, sherried aromas rise from the glass: dark raisins and prune mingle with fig, burnt orange zest and cocoa. Rich vanilla, toffee and a touch of caramel weave through the fruit, while oak spice—cinnamon and clove—lends depth, with whispers of leather and tobacco completing a refined, aged perfume.
Palate
Silky, full-bodied and firmly sherried, with dark fruit compote of fig and prune, folded with orange zest, cocoa and caramel. Rich vanilla and toasted oak provide backbone as spices glow: cinnamon, clove and a hint of ginger, leading to a long, velvety finish that lingers with raisin, espresso and wood spice.
Finish
Long, luxurious finish with sherried fruit depth—raisin, fig and orange peel—softly evolving into dark chocolate, toasted almond, and spice. The oak lingers as a warm, velvety glow, leaving a refined, enduring sweetness that coats the palate.
